nginx: [error] open() "/usr/local/nginx/logs/nginx.pid" failed (2: No such file or directory) 解决: 先试试nginx -c /usr/local/nginx/conf/nginx.conf 如果不行的话,杀掉 nginx 进程,重新跑killall -9 nginxnginx -c /usr/local/nginx/conf/nginx.conf/usr/local/nginx/sbin/nginx 配置nginx...
2、看到是PID为4636的进程占用了9601端口,如果进一步想知道它的进程名称,可以使用如下命令: tasklist | findstr "4636" 奇迹出现了,显示了应用的名字,那就好办了
第一步、强行停止nginx进程 pkill -9 nginx 1. 2、开启nginx进程 ps -ef | grep nginx 1. 3、重新配置nginx.conf文件 nginx -c /etc/nginx/nginx.conf 1.
1)通过tasklist | findstr"nginx.exe"查出nginx.exe对应的PID; 2)在xxx/logs/下新建文本文件nginx.pid,通过文本编辑器将上一步的PID写入(当然,这一步也可以通过命令行、脚本、动手编程等一切能达到目的的方式进行); 3)执行nginx -s stop或nginx -s quit或nginx -s reload。 验证 【必读】 本验证中,nginx安...
然后进行上两层目录,回到根目录 nginx-release-1.23,执行: auto/configure \ --with-cc=cl \ --with-debug \ --prefix= \ --conf-path=conf/nginx.conf \ --pid-path=logs/nginx.pid \ --http-log-path=logs/access.log \ --error-log-path=logs/error.log \ ...
http://nginx.org 2)启动 解压至c:nginx,运行nginx.exe(即nginx -c confnginx.conf),默认使用80端口,日志见文件夹C:nginxlogs 3)使用 http://localhost 4)关闭 nginx -s stop 或taskkill /F /IM nginx.exe > nul 5)常用配置 C:nginxconfnginx.conf,使用自己定义的conf文件如my.conf,命令为nginx -c ...
直接任务管理器找到nginx就行了
之前是Windows 7系统,前段时间装了Windows 10,php环境还没来得及搭建。今天折腾了一下,是用nginx+php,端口是80(已经停止了iis服务),nginx就是起不来,十之八九就是端口被占用了。 发现 使用端口映射查看命令netstat -ano,发现80端口是被pid为4的System进程占用,按以前的经验:一是被IIS占用;二是SQL Server Report...
permissions) nginx: configuration file E:\nginx-1.17.8/conf/nginx.conf test failed 显示的这个,然后我查了一下,是80端口被占用,pid值为4 TCP 0.0.0.0:80 0.0.0.0:0 LISTENING 4 我查找4这个端口对应的服务名称 System 4 Services 0 10,760 K 结果查到是System这个服务名称,我上网查了下这个服务不能...